Runbook: Driftnet crash-report pipeline, stage 3 (symbol upload). Before re-running the symbol uploader, verify the artifact checksum against the Ledgerline manifest and confirm the uploader runs under the restricted service account, never a personal one. All calls to the Coalpit symbol store are audited and TLS-only. The uploader authenticates to Coalpit with the internal API key shown below.

API key for fahip-kahip: zpat23_XiJGUHz5xfaAtaIqUkus0rh

Subject: Heads up — compaction lag on the Brindlemere queue

Hey all, quick note before the sync: log compaction on the Brindlemere brokers fell behind over the weekend, so tombstoned keys lingered about six hours longer than our SLO. No data loss, just bloated segment files and some grumpy disk alerts. We've bumped the compactor thread count and segment roll size on the canary broker. Results look good so far. The canary is running the following build.

build token for fahaf-hadug: htk14_7ab1a4227c9f5d

Vendor Note: Telemetry Payload Compression

Plugin authors shipping telemetry to the Quillhaven ingest tier must compress payloads with the zstd profile defined in our vendor compliance sheet. Uncompressed batches over 64 KB are rejected at the edge, and repeated rejections can suspend your vendor key. Please validate against the staging endpoint before your next certification window. Questions about compression profiles or certification should be sent to the ingest vendor desk.

escalation mailbox, bafog-fafog: ulador@paliqlabs.internal